Adult stem cells are located in several select areas in stemcell the body, generally known as niches, like All those inside the bone marrow or gonads. They exist to replenish fast dropped cell types and so are multipotent or unipotent, meaning they only differentiate right into a few cell forms or 1 style of cell. In mammals, they consist of, between Other individuals, hematopoietic stem cells, which replenish blood and immune cells, basal cells, which manage the pores and skin epithelium, and mesenchymal stem cells, which sustain bone, cartilage, muscle mass and fat cells.

By natural means happening stem cells isolated from humans are actually applied therapeutically for many years. This has mostly concerned the transplantation of primary cells which include haematopoietic and mesenchymal stem cells and, additional just lately, derivatives of pluripotent stem cells. Nonetheless, the advent of cell-engineering approaches is ushering in a brand new technology of stem cell-dependent therapies, drastically expanding their therapeutic utility. These next-technology stem cells are being used as ‘Trojan horses’ to improve the delivery of medicine and oncolytic viruses to intractable tumours and will also be getting engineered with angiogenic, neurotrophic and anti-inflammatory molecules to accelerate the maintenance of hurt or diseased tissues.
